> If I'm reading the reflections, properly, the top of the tank is slightly
> dished.  By placing a bit of gasoline in the dished part, then lighting
it,
> the contents will become pressurized.  If my surmise is correct, it does
not
> need a pressure pump.
>
> I would think, however, the filler cap is missing.  It appears as though
it
> has been lost and a jury-rigged stopper has been inserted.  In order for
it
> to work properly, a proper cap should be provided.
>
> I have a backpacking stove that works in the manner described.
